- This is the cover card for Cybernetic Revolution, as well as one of the cover cards for Expert Edition Volume 4/Dark Revelation Volume 4, and Prismatic Art Collection.
- This monster appears in the artworks of "Cyber Network", "Cybernetic Revolution", "Cyber Eternal" "Fusion Buster", and "Super Strident Blaze".
- This monster appears in its second OCG/TCG artwork in the artwork of "Cybernetic Horizon".
- This card is the signature card of Zane Truesdale, which later came under the ownership of his brother, Syrus Truesdale.
- This card has a "Malefic" counterpart: "Malefic Cyber End Dragon".
- Since October 5, 2017, this card's Spanish text listed on the Yu-Gi-Oh! Trading Card Game - Card Database is the Spanish text of "Malefic Cyber End Dragon".
- This card's DEF is equal to the ATK of "Cyber Twin Dragon" much like the DEF of "Cyber Twin Dragon" is equal to the ATK of "Cyber Dragon".
- The three "Cyber Dragons" fused in this card have different head designs in this card's artworks.
- The head on the left bears resemblance to "Proto-Cyber Dragon", while the head on the right bears resemblance to "Cyber Dragon Zwei".
- This monster's appearance may be based on Mecha-King Ghidorah.
- While this monster isn't the an upgraded form of a main rival's ace monster, it could be considered the Yu-Gi-Oh! GX series' counterpart of "Blue-Eyes Ultimate Dragon", succeeded by "Neo Galaxy-Eyes Photon Dragon" in Yu-Gi-Oh! ZEXAL, in which all monsters feature a draconic appearance with three heads.
- It would later get a spiritual successor in the form of "Borrelend Dragon", which was released in the Yu-Gi-Oh! VRAINS era.
- This is the first Fusion Monster in Yu-Gi-Oh! Rush Duel to list more than 2 Fusion Materials.
